The Connecticut Storyteller’s Festival April 29-May 1, at Connecticut College in New London is the perfect place to get this relaxing and entertaining break. Friday night is family night and kids are welcome from 6:30- 9 p.m., April 29 for “Once and Twice Upon a Time”. I can’t say enough positive things about this evening. I took my kids last year and we LOVED it. There are no refreshments served for the early evening crowd.
Bring a bottle of water - we were parched by the end of the show. It opens with a contra dance in the lobby and the show starts at 7:30. Have Grandma and Grandpa bring the kids so they feel they have been treated to something special while you get yourselves ready to go away for the weekend. The adult’s only evening starts at 9:30 p.m., with “Mid-Nine Cabaret.”
